Clashes shatter illusion of security in Libyan capital
CAIRO/TRIPOLI (Reuters) - A bout of fighting in Libya's capital has laid bare the fragility of a militia cartel that had brought a veneer of stability to the city and encouraged the gradual return of foreign diplomats and plans for elections in December.
